ATbar is a web browser toolbar, [1] is available with a BSD licence and uses innovative JavaScript techniques to enhance the accessibility of web pages. Unlike other toolbars it does not require a download, enabling it to be used on networked computers that do not allow installations.
The original repository for ATBar is on GitHub but updates since 2014 can be found on BitBucket. All issues or bugs associated with ATBar should be filed on the Bitbucket site.
